A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, particularly a dishwashing machine adapter, connects the dish washer to a water resource. A plumber can make sure that the line is suitable with both your dish washer and water source if you acquire a new supply line. If you make a decision to make use of an existing supply line, a professional plumber can examine it to make certain that it's in good condition as well as does not have any leakages.

Not Installing Your Dishwasher Correctly Can Result In a Mountain of Issues


Not just can setting up a dishwasher properly void your service warranty, however it can likewise produce a mess. If you do not install the supply line appropriately, you could deal with leakages-- or even wor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too swiftly via your pipelines as well as triggers loud drinking sounds. Finally, if you improperly install your dishwasher to the garbage disposal, you may discover pungent smells or have residue on your dishes.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her


DIY Dishwasher Installation


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.


Items needed for dishwasher removal and installation:


  • Cardboard or blanket to protect flooring

  • Two adjustable wrenches

  • Screwdriver

  • Tape measure

  • Pair of pliers

  • Level

  • Bucket

  • Rag
